opencoti-llamafile
Self-contained single-file inference engine from the opencoti project — a Mozilla-Ocho llamafile 0.10.3 base carrying the opencoti patch series: advanced KV residency/quantization (PolyKV/TurboQuant/TCQ), rolling-KV window with host-RAM spill, DCA long-context extension, MTP speculative decode, sparse attention, RYS layer duplication, and a runtime introspection/control API.
Start with USAGE.md — it explains exactly how this engine diverges from upstream llamafile, every added feature, its flags, defaults, limitations, and which features compose.

The APE host binary runs natively on both x86_64 and aarch64; the two
artifacts differ only in the embedded ggml-cuda.so. On a platform
with no matching DSO, inference falls back to CPU.

On the first GPU run the embedded CUDA DSO self-extracts to
~/.llamafile/v/<ver>/. --version prints the opencoti version
string; GET /props exposes an opencoti introspection section at
runtime (see USAGE.md §introspection).
Verification
Each artifact ships with a MANIFEST.json recording the artifact
sha256, versionString, gitCommit, the full patch list, and the sha256
of every embedded backend DSO; releases/<tag>/SHA256SUMS is the
committed contract (CI verifies this repo's LFS blobs against it on
every release tag). Verify the embedded DSO without running:
unzip -p opencoti-llamafile-*.llamafile ggml-cuda.so | sha256sum
